Output 39503469e2a01f48c2b51d5b4f4eeb643977a6fc2086096ad1183dd5463ba27f:1

value
108422592
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a6423a4e75611614b674f84a485dc88f9b0b7152 OP_EQUAL
address
3Gr7RyPV2N1vNx1RQgxpX693aSFGg1s77U
transaction
39503469e2a01f48c2b51d5b4f4eeb643977a6fc2086096ad1183dd5463ba27f
spent
true